    How Does the Selection Process Work?

    Okay, so you're probably wondering how someone actually gets chosen for IOSCNSC Zone Sports All American. The selection process can be pretty intense, but here’s a breakdown of the typical steps involved. First off, nominations are usually submitted by coaches, athletic directors, or even sports journalists who have been keeping a close eye on the athletes. These nominations include a detailed overview of the athlete’s performance throughout the season, including stats, key achievements, and any notable contributions to their team. Next, a selection committee, composed of experienced coaches, sports experts, and sometimes even former athletes, reviews these nominations. The committee evaluates each athlete based on a range of criteria, not just raw talent. They look at things like game statistics (e.g., points scored, batting average, save percentage), leadership qualities (e.g., team captain, role model), sportsmanship (e.g., fair play, respect for opponents), and overall impact on the team's success. Some programs might also consider academic performance or community involvement as part of the evaluation process. Once the committee has reviewed all the nominations, they’ll usually have a series of meetings to discuss and debate the merits of each candidate. This can involve analyzing game footage, reviewing performance reports, and even interviewing coaches or teammates to get a more complete picture of the athlete’s abilities and character. Finally, after careful deliberation, the committee selects the athletes who they believe best embody the spirit of IOSCNSC Zone Sports All American. The chosen athletes are then notified and publicly recognized, often at an awards ceremony or banquet. The selection process aims to be as fair and objective as possible, ensuring that the most deserving athletes are honored for their achievements and contributions to their respective sports.

    Tips for Aspiring All American Athletes

    So, you're dreaming of becoming an IOSCNSC Zone Sports All American? That’s awesome! Here are a few tips to help you on your journey. First and foremost, focus on developing your skills and technique. This means putting in the extra hours to practice, working with experienced coaches, and constantly seeking feedback to improve your game. Don’t just go through the motions; be intentional about your training and always strive to get better. Next, pay attention to your physical conditioning. Being in top shape is essential for performing at your best and avoiding injuries. This includes regular workouts, a balanced diet, and adequate rest and recovery. Work with a trainer or nutritionist to create a personalized fitness plan that meets your specific needs and goals. In addition to physical skills, focus on developing your mental toughness. Sports can be mentally challenging, and it’s important to be able to handle pressure, overcome adversity, and stay focused on your goals. Practice visualization techniques, mindfulness exercises, and positive self-talk to build your mental resilience. Also, be a great teammate. Sports are often a team effort, and your success depends on your ability to work well with others, support your teammates, and contribute to the overall team dynamic. Be a leader, a role model, and someone who always puts the team first. Finally, stay committed to your academics. College recruiters and selection committees often consider academic performance as part of the evaluation process, so it’s important to maintain good grades and demonstrate your commitment to your education. Remember, being an All American is not just about athletic ability; it’s about being a well-rounded individual who excels in all areas of life. By following these tips and staying dedicated to your goals, you’ll increase your chances of achieving your dream of becoming an IOSCNSC Zone Sports All American.
